Project Manager Responsibilities:

  1. Project Planning: Lead and oversee glazing projects from inception to completion. Develop comprehensive project plans, budgets, and timelines, considering all relevant factors, including manpower, materials, equipment, and safety measures.
  2. Client Communication: Establish and maintain strong relationships with clients, architects, contractors, and other stakeholders. Ensure effective communication channels to address concerns, provide progress updates, and manage expectations throughout the project lifecycle.
  3. Resource Management: Coordinate with internal teams and external vendors to ensure the availability of necessary resources, including skilled labor, materials, and equipment, to meet project requirements on time and within budget.
  4. Quality Control: Implement rigorous quality control processes to guarantee the highest standard of workmanship and compliance with industry standards and safety regulations.
  5. Budget and Cost Management: Monitor project expenses and analyze cost reports regularly to identify potential cost-saving opportunities and avoid budget overruns.
  6. Risk Assessment: Identify potential project risks and develop risk mitigation strategies to ensure projects are completed safely and without interruptions.
  7. Schedule Management: Monitor project progress and take necessary actions to keep projects on schedule, adjusting plans as needed to accommodate changes and unforeseen circumstances.
  8. Safety Compliance: Promote and enforce a strong safety culture, ensuring that all team members and contractors adhere to safety protocols and regulations.
  9. Documentation: Maintain accurate and up-to-date project documentation, including contracts, change orders, progress reports, and relevant correspondence.

Project Manager Qualifications:

  1. Proven experience as a Project Manager in the glazing industry, with at least 3 years of relevant project management experience.
  2. Strong technical knowledge of glazing systems, façade installation, and related construction methodologies.
  3. Excellent leadership and interpersonal skills with the ability to motivate and coordinate teams effectively.
  4. Exceptional organizational and time management abilities, capable of managing multiple projects simultaneously.
  5. Proficient in project management software and tools.
  6. Strong problem-solving and decision-making capabilities.
  7. Demonstrated ability to communicate effectively with clients, team members, and stakeholders.
  8. Knowledge of relevant building codes, regulations, and safety standards.
  9. Valid driver's license and ability to travel to project sites as required.
